Restituisce un evento in base al suo ID Google Calendar. Per recuperare un evento utilizzando il relativo ID iCalendar, chiama il metodo events.list utilizzando il parametro iCalUID
.
Prova subito o guarda un esempio.
Richiesta
Richiesta HTTP
GET https://www.googleapis.com/calendar/v3/calendars/calendarId/events/eventId
Parametri
Nome del parametro | Valore | Descrizione |
---|---|---|
Parametri percorso | ||
calendarId |
string |
Identificatore di calendario. Per recuperare gli ID calendario, chiama il metodo calendarList.list. Se vuoi accedere al calendario principale dell'utente che ha eseguito l'accesso, usa "primary " parola chiave.
|
eventId |
string |
Identificatore dell'evento. |
Parametri di query facoltativi | ||
alwaysIncludeEmail |
boolean |
Deprecato e ignorato. Verrà sempre restituito un valore nel campo email per l'organizzatore, l'autore e i partecipanti, anche se non è disponibile un indirizzo email reale (ovvero, verrà fornito un valore generato e non funzionante).
|
maxAttendees |
integer |
Il numero massimo di partecipanti da includere nella risposta. Se il numero di partecipanti supera quello specificato, viene restituito solo il partecipante. (Facoltativo) |
timeZone |
string |
Fuso orario utilizzato nella risposta. (Facoltativo) Il valore predefinito è il fuso orario del calendario. |
Autorizzazione
Questa richiesta consente l'autorizzazione con almeno uno dei seguenti ambiti:
Ambito |
---|
https://www.googleapis.com/auth/calendar.readonly |
https://www.googleapis.com/auth/calendar |
https://www.googleapis.com/auth/calendar.events.readonly |
https://www.googleapis.com/auth/calendar.events |
Per ulteriori informazioni, consulta la pagina Autenticazione e autorizzazione.
Corpo della richiesta
Non fornire un corpo della richiesta con questo metodo.
Risposta
In caso di esito positivo, questo metodo restituisce una risorsa Eventi nel corpo della risposta.
Esempi
Nota: gli esempi di codice disponibili per questo metodo non rappresentano tutti i linguaggi di programmazione supportati (consulta la pagina relativa alle librerie client per un elenco dei linguaggi supportati).
Java
Utilizza la libreria client Java.
import com.google.api.services.calendar.Calendar; import com.google.api.services.calendar.model.Event; // ... // Initialize Calendar service with valid OAuth credentials Calendar service = new Calendar.Builder(httpTransport, jsonFactory, credentials) .setApplicationName("applicationName").build(); // Retrieve an event Event event = service.events().get('primary', "eventId").execute(); System.out.println(event.getSummary());
Python
Utilizza la libreria client Python.
event = service.events().get(calendarId='primary', eventId='eventId').execute() print event['summary']
PHP
Utilizza la libreria client PHP.
$event = $service->events->get('primary', "eventId"); echo $event->getSummary();
Ruby
Utilizza la libreria client Ruby.
result = client.get_event('primary', 'eventId') print result.summary
Prova
Usa Explorer API in basso per chiamare questo metodo sui dati in tempo reale e visualizzare la risposta.